THC vs CBD for Stress: Understanding the Difference in Relief
While both cannabinoids combat stress, THC offers a psychoactive escape while CBD provides a non-intoxicating somatic calm. THC locks onto the brain's CB1 receptors and changes perception, usually giving a "head change" that lets a person step away from stressful thoughts. The high offers a clear break from reality plus helps a person relax. CBD acts on the endocannabinoid system with a lighter touch - it slows the breakdown of the body's own endocannabinoids. It eases muscle tightness and low-level worry without dulling the mind. When stress is intense, THC delivers stronger relief - when the day demands attention but also alertness, CBD is normally the better option.
The Entourage Effect: Why Combining THC and CBD Works Best for Calm
Combining cannabinoids often yields superior stress relief compared to using isolated compounds, a phenomenon known as the Entourage Effect. CBD alters the CB1 receptor - reducing its sensitivity to THC, "softening" how tightly THC binds. If CBD joins a THC dose, it lessens the chance that THC will trigger paranoia or a racing heartbeat - reactions that often block the very stress relief sought. A ratio of one part CBD to one part THC or two parts CBD to one part THC, delivers the mood elevation of THC while CBD calms anxiety - the pair together fosters steady, whole body ease.

Buy Delta 9 THC for Stress Online: Farm Bill Compliant and Legal
You can legally purchase potent Delta 9 THC products for stress relief online thanks to specific federal regulations. Agriculture Improvement Act of 2018, The law - widely called the Farm Bill - removed hemp and its compounds from the controlled list as long as the finished item carries no more than 0.3 percent Delta-9 THC by dry weight. Because that limit applies to each piece, a four gram gummy may legally hold ten milligrams of Delta-9 plus still meet federal rules. Citizens in every state thereby gain a tested, above board route to ease tension without first securing a medical cannabis card.
Edibles vs Vaping for Stress Relief: Onset Time and Duration
Edibles offer sustained, systemic relief ideal for chronic burnout, whereas vaping provides immediate, short-term reduction for acute stress spikes. When you inhale vapor, Delta-9 THC reaches the bloodstream almost at once through the lungs and peaks within fifteen to thirty minutes, which gives rapid help for anxiety that appears suddenly. By contrast, travel through the digestive tract - the liver changes THC into 11-hydroxy-THC, a strong metabolite that delivers profound calm for six to eight hours plus is therefore more appropriate for stress that lasts.

How Does THC Reduce Stress? The Science of the Endocannabinoid System
THC reduces stress by binding to CB1 receptors in the amygdala, the brain's fear center, effectively dampening the threat response. When a person takes in THC, it copies anandamide, a natural cannabinoid that people call the "bliss molecule". THC locks onto the same receptors and helps the brain manage feelings plus softens the reaction to stress. Trials show that a small amount of THC clearly reduces self reported distress during psychosocial stress tests, as reported in studies issued by the NCBI/NIH.
